In a recent development that has rippled through the gaming industry, Nintendo Co. has experienced a downturn in share value following reports of a delay in the launch of its next-generation console. The Tokyo-based gaming behemoth, renowned for its innovative contributions to the industry, has postponed the release of its highly anticipated console successor to the Switch until early 2025. This news comes as the enterprise approaches the eighth anniversary of the Switch, a period marked by robust sales and consumer engagement.

The Kyoto-based institution has recently revised its full-year sales projections for the Switch upward, signaling a continued strong market presence. During a financial briefing, Shuntaro Furukawa, President of Nintendo, underscored the strategic imperative of sustaining the Switch’s market momentum. The postponement, the Switch has achieved remarkable sales, with 139 million units sold, underscoring its enduring appeal. Nonetheless, the absence of a new hardware offering for the forthcoming holiday season places the firm in direct competition with the latest consoles from other industry titans.

The postponement of the next-generation console has broader implications, particularly for Nintendo’s software release calendar. The enterprise may delay the introduction of new installments in its flagship series, including Legend of Zelda, Mario and Splatoon, until the new console debuts. Software sales are integral to the corporation’s revenue, with new titles traditionally aligned with hardware launches to optimize their market impact.
